Robert Oatley Signature Series Chardonnay

With not only Robert 'Bob' Oatley's signature on the label, the wine itself has the signature of winemaker Larry Cherubino all over it. Supple and elegant along power and poise are all trademarks of the award winning WA winemaker; all of which are on display here with the Signature Series Chardonnay from Margaret River. Stone fruit notes greet the nose which are then reflected onto the palate that has a length of flavour befitting of a premium Chardonnay.

Heggies Above 500m Chardonnay

Heggies Above 500m Chardonnay shows fresh aromas of citrus zest, quince and white flowers, with an underlying hint of spicy oak. A zesty and lively palate, with ripe quince and stone fruit flavours, balanced by a crisp acidity which drives the palate length. Subtle nuances of fine French oak complement the fresh varietal expression.

Château Martinolles Limoux Chardonnay

Château Martinolles Limoux is bright gold in colour. On the nose - complex with tropical fruit aromas, oak, brioche and toast. To taste, full-bodied rich and creamy notes. Elegant with a long toasty finish and best served with seafood, white meat in creamy sauce or as an aperitif.

Cherry Tree Hill Chardonnay

The 2015 Cherry Tree Hill Chardonnay is a great example of a cool climate wine. The depth of amazing fruit is complimented perfectly by subtle oak tannins integrated from ten months ageing in large format French and Hungarian oak barrels.
